WebThe position compensation loop, which is often, but not always, a PID (Proportional, Integral, Derivative) loop, continuously tries to have the actual position equal the commanded position. Any external perturbation will make the job of the PID harder and thus increase the tracking error. WebEarly dynamic positioning systems were implemented using PID controllers. In order to restrain thruster trembling caused by the wave-induced motion components, notch fil-ters in cascade with low pass filters were used with the controllers. WebDec 31, 2024 · A PID (Proportional Integral Derivative) controller consists of three components that are adjusted based on the difference between a set point ( SP) and a measured process variable ( PV ). e(t) =SP −P V e ( t) = S P − P V.
